PlatformIO failing to parse manifest on install. #722
Comments
The issue appears to stem from the header included in the JSON file:
PlatformIO doesn't recognize the JSON file with this there. I forked the project here and literally the only change I made was to delete that, and it works. I also noticed that removing the dependency from the pio ini let pio install the library itself from its registry, which is a working version labelled as 2.6.0 without the JSON header.
